Alphonse Gabriel Capone, notoriously since "Scarface," ruled the streets of Chicago for over a decade (1919 - 1930) During these years, Capone rose to power through any means necessary, including but was not limited to: bootlegging, gambling, prostitution, assault, theft, arson, and murder. When Elliot Ness brought down Capone in 1930, the authorities did never enough evidence to charge him with any of the above incidents. However, it is hardly surprising that the most famous Gagster in American History was arrested and jailed solely for income tax evasion.
